Lotte Department Store announced Monday it will serve as an official partner in the UNESCO World Heritage Fund fundraising campaign led by the Justpeace Foundation, in conjunction with the 48th UNESCO World Heritage Committee session.
The Justpeace Foundation is a public-interest foundation established on the basis of copyright donations by global artist G-Dragon. Lotte Department Store signed an MOU with the foundation on Friday. The two organizations plan to roll out a range of fundraising campaigns to raise awareness of the value of world heritage protection and build broader public interest in the cause.
The first event will be held at the Korea Pavilion of the World Heritage Committee at BEXCO in Busan from July 20 to 29. Visitors will receive a limited-edition UNESCO-designed transit card. A world heritage quiz event will also run on the Lotte Department Store app.
"We are honored to help spread awareness of the importance of cultural heritage conservation and contribute to expanding the social value needed for a sustainable future for world heritage," said Park Sang-woo, head of marketing at Lotte Department Store.
